Farm & Ranch Management

Department of Agricultural and Resource Economics Cooperative Extension faculty develop farm budgets and a variety of tools and templates to assist with budgeting and decision-making for farming and ranching enterprises. This information is useful not only to producers for short- and long-term planning and decision-making for their agricultural enterprises, but is of interest to researchers, policy makers, financial institutions, and others that would like more specific information about farm and ranch management.

Tools & Resources

Department of Agricultural and Resource Economics faculty have developed a number of tools, resources, and templates that can be customized to individual operations to assist Arizona farmers, ranchers, and other agricultural managers.

  • Financial Templates Generate budget information customized to an individual operation on an operating or cash cost basis only (fixed costs are not included).
  • Small Farms Cost Estimator Calculate profitability and break-even values for different crops and plan crop mix for a small operation. An introduction to the tool can be found here
  • Field Crop Templates* Field crop budgets that can be easily modified to reflect local input costs.
  • Ranch Restocking Decision Aid Spreadsheet* Allows for differences in biological productivity of purchased versus raised replacements and allows a rancher to compare the long-term financial consequences associated with alternative restocking paths, including unforeseen drought.
  • Crop Solver* Optimizes a crop mix of up to 20 different crops subject to annual land, monthly labor, water, and capital, plus alternative risk constraints. Developed as part of educational programs funded by the U.S. Department of Agriculture Risk Management Agency.
  • Oil Seed Cost Estimation and Comparison Spreadsheet* Evaluate production and break-even points for four different oilseed crops.
  • Livestock Records Workbooks* Helps producers with limited access to computers and internet better record and manage their livestock. Supported by grants from the Western Extension Committee.
  • Nursery Cost Estimator and Nursery Insurance Tools Tool available for purchase that helps nursery producers address space allocation decisions to different "crop mixes," manage inventory, set pricing points, quantify differences in production cost for primary container sizes, and analyze nursery crop insurance. Developed as part of educational programs funded by the U.S. Department of Agriculture Risk Management Agency.

*Available upon request.

As members of the Western Extension Committee, Department of Agricultural and Resource Economics Cooperative Extension faculty also collaborate with Extension specialists through the West and nation to develop tools and resources for farmers, ranchers, other agricultural managers, and Extension educators. 

  • AgPlan Helps rural businesses develop a business plan. AgPlan is free of charge for anyone to use individually or in educational programs.
  • AgTransitions Helps farmers & ranchers develop a plan to transition their business to the next generation.
  • Diverse Agriculture Money Management Curriculum Eight-module curriculum developed to help students of the class understand their financial standing and create a plan that will help them succeed in improving their financial future.
  • Diverse Agriculture Business Management Curriculum Seven-module curriculum designed to help prospective entrepreneurs develop their ideas, find markets for them, generate financial statements and budgets, and navigate the tax issues that arise from being self-employed.
  • Rural Tax Education Tools and resources for farmers, ranchers, other agricultural managers, and Extension educators about agriculture-related income and self-employment tax topics.
